CAD Engineer

1 Month ago • 2 Years + • Research & Development

Job Summary

Job Description

NVIDIA's VLSI Productivity and Infrastructure team seeks a self-sufficient CAD Engineer to automate workflows for chip design engineers. Responsibilities include designing, developing, deploying, and improving scalable workflows and automation platforms for compute-intensive workloads. This involves understanding user workflows, planning automation strategies, working with legacy and new systems (Perl, Python, Make), using version control (Perforce, Gitlab), and collaborating with chip designers to standardize and improve their processes. The ideal candidate possesses strong programming fundamentals, experience with enterprise workflow automation, and an understanding of UNIX processes, concurrency, and load balancing. EDA/C++ experience is a plus.
Must have:
  • M.S. CS or equivalent
  • 2+ years experience
  • Strong programming skills
  • Workflow automation experience
  • Enterprise setting experience
  • Understanding of UNIX processes
Good to have:
  • EDA/C++ Tools development
  • Perl, Make, VLSI flow experience
  • Problem-solving in large systems
  • NFS and job-scheduling (LSF)
Perks:
  • Industry-leading salaries
  • Generous benefits package

Job Details

We are looking for self-sufficient full-time software engineers with a strong desire to build high-quality, long-lasting workflows. The VLSI Productivity and Infrastructure team supports hundreds of chip design engineers by building internal tools and platforms that supercharge their everyday work. From build automation to machine learning, databases to web applications, and on-prem compute to cloud workloads, this team handles it all!

Although every member of our team is multi-faceted, the focus for this role is on automating workflows for user-friendliness, maintainability, and extensibility. You will work closely with chip designers to thoroughly understand their daily work and help standardize, automate and improve their process, which will then be deployed using our custom build system. You won't be designing chips or running hardware flows (except to test your automation). On a typical day, you might work with both legacy and new systems in Perl, Python, and Make, using Perforce and Gitlab to deploy your work. You should also be proactive in improving our own team's productivity, championing software development best-practices, and sharing that knowledge with the larger team. If you embrace abstraction and have an intuition for decomposing ambiguous, highly coupled systems, we believe you will fit right in.

What you will be doing:

  • Responsible for current and next-generation workflow automation for VLSI chip engineers

  • Design, develop, deploy, and improve highly scalable, long shelf-life workflows and automation platforms for compute and memory-heavy workloads

  • Deconstruct user workflows into actionable tasks and plan a pathway to automation

What we need to see:

  • M.S. CS/related (or equivalent experience) with 2+ years developing engineering-facing workflows in an enterprise setting

  • Solid programming fundamentals in algorithms/data structures with a multi-year history of maintaining platforms in production

  • EDA / C++ Tools development experience is a plus

  • Excellent grasp of polyglot systems and the intertwining of workflows and UNIX processes, concurrency and load-balancing

Ways to stand out from the crowd:

  • Experience seeking and solving problems in partitioning and optimizing existing interconnected systems

  • Understand NFS and job-scheduling within the constraints of IT-managed LSF infrastructure

  • Exposure to Perl, Make and VLSI flows, alongside robust design ideals

With industry-leading salaries and a generous benefits package, we are widely considered to be one of the technology world’s most desirable employers. The most forward-thinking engineers in the world do their life’s work at NVIDIA. If you're creative and autonomous, with a real passion for technology, we want to hear from you!

#LI-Hybrid

Similar Jobs

YOOM - Motion Capture Production Specialist

YOOM

Los Angeles, California, United States (On-Site)
9 Months ago
Google - Engineering Analyst, Trust and Safety Search

Google

Dublin, County Dublin, Ireland (On-Site)
2 Weeks ago
Whoop - Business Analytics Manager (Healthcare Product)

Whoop

Boston, Massachusetts, United States (On-Site)
6 Days ago
ByteDance - Immersive Video Research Intern (Multimedia Streaming) 2023 Summer/Fall (BS)

ByteDance

Seattle, Washington, United States (On-Site)
6 Months ago
Onward Search - Community Manager (Social Media)

Onward Search

Santa Monica, California, United States (Hybrid)
2 Weeks ago
Google - Software Engineer III, Auto Exposure, Pixel Camera

Google

New Taipei City, Taiwan (On-Site)
2 Weeks ago
ByteDance - Senior Research Scientist, Foundation Model, Speech Understanding

ByteDance

Seattle, Washington, United States (On-Site)
6 Months ago
ByteDance - Linux System Engineer

ByteDance

London, England, United Kingdom (On-Site)
3 Months ago
Google - ASIC Power Management Architect, Silicon

Google

Bengaluru, Karnataka, India (On-Site)
2 Weeks ago
Microsoft - Research Intern - Applied Sciences Group (Computer Vision)

Microsoft

Redmond, Washington, United States (On-Site)
1 Week 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Google - Software Engineer, Site Reliability Engineering, YouTube Data

Google

Zürich, Zurich, Switzerland (On-Site)
2 Weeks ago
Interactive Brokers - Advertising Coordinator & Influencer Manager

Interactive Brokers

Greenwich, Connecticut, United States (Hybrid)
8 Hours ago
Snyk - Software Engineer

Snyk

London, England, United Kingdom (On-Site)
7 Hours ago
ByteDance - Student Researcher (Doubao (Seed) - Foundation Model - Generative AI) - 2025 Start (PhD)

ByteDance

San Jose, California, United States (On-Site)
6 Months ago
ByteDance - Software Engineer, Model Interference

ByteDance

San Jose, California, United States (On-Site)
3 Months ago
ByteDance - Senior Site Reliability Engineer, AI Applications

ByteDance

San Jose, California, United States (On-Site)
5 Months ago
ByteDance - Product Operations, Search Ads AI Data Service - Trust & Safety

ByteDance

Pasig, Metro Manila, Philippines (On-Site)
1 Month ago
ByteDance - Senior Software Development Engineer, Large Language Models & Generative AI

ByteDance

San Jose, California, United States (On-Site)
6 Months ago
ByteDance - Video Experience Software Engineer Intern

ByteDance

San Jose, California, United States (On-Site)
1 Month ago

Get notifed when new similar jobs are uploaded

Jobs in Bengaluru, Karnataka, India

Assystems - Mechanical Design Engineer (PHE + Fire Fighting)

Assystems

Gurugram, Haryana, India (On-Site)
6 Months ago
Beghou Consulting - Data Science Manager

Beghou Consulting

Pune, Maharashtra, India (Hybrid)
1 Month ago
NVIDIA - Silicon Power Performance Engineer

NVIDIA

Bengaluru, Karnataka, India (Hybrid)
1 Month ago
Zenoti - Lead Product Manager, Data & Analytics

Zenoti

Hyderabad, Telangana, India (On-Site)
23 Hours ago
Mindtickle - Group Product Manager

Mindtickle

Bengaluru, Karnataka, India (On-Site)
1 Month ago
Assystems - Senior Developer – Team Lead

Assystems

Gurugram, Haryana, India (On-Site)
6 Months ago
Nagarro - Associate Principal Engineer, Java Fullstack

Nagarro

India (Remote)
6 Months ago
World Resource Institute - Intern – Safe, Vibrant and Healthy Public Spaces Project for Adolescents

World Resource Institute

Jaipur, Rajasthan, India (On-Site)
1 Month ago
Xogar Games - Senior Vehicle Artist

Xogar Games

Bengaluru, Karnataka, India (On-Site)
4 Months ago
Postman - Senior Engineer, Postbot

Postman

Bengaluru, Karnataka, India (Hybrid)
1 Day ago

Get notifed when new similar jobs are uploaded

Research & Development Jobs

Rivos - Silicon Power - Full-time

Rivos

Bengaluru, Karnataka, India (Hybrid)
6 Months ago
Microsoft - Senior Silicon Engineer

Microsoft

Bengaluru, Karnataka, India (On-Site)
2 Weeks ago
Meta - Software Engineer, Machine Learning

Meta

Austin, Texas, United States (Remote)
2 Weeks ago
Google - ASIC Design Engineer, Platform IP, Silicon

Google

Mountain View, California, United States (On-Site)
2 Weeks ago
NVIDIA - System Software Engineer, GPU Tools Development

NVIDIA

Bengaluru, Karnataka, India (Hybrid)
3 Weeks ago
Riot Games - Manager, Learning and Development

Riot Games

United States (On-Site)
1 Month ago
Krafton  - Strategic Planning Manager, India Division

Krafton

Seoul, South Korea (On-Site)
1 Month ago
Trend Micro - Embedded Software Engineer (C/C++)

Trend Micro

Manila, Metro Manila, Philippines (On-Site)
16 Years ago
NVIDIA - Silicon Power Performance Engineer

NVIDIA

Bengaluru, Karnataka, India (Hybrid)
1 Month ago
Riot Games - Researcher III - Player Platform

Riot Games

United States (On-Site)
3 Days ago

Get notifed when new similar jobs are uploaded

About The Company

Since its founding in 1993, NVIDIA (NASDAQ: NVDA) has been a pioneer in accelerated computing. The company’s invention of the GPU in 1999 sparked the growth of the PC gaming market, redefined computer graphics, ignited the era of modern AI and is fueling the creation of the metaverse. NVIDIA is now a full-stack computing company with data-center-scale offerings that are reshaping industry.

Santa Clara, California, United States (On-Site)

Santa Clara, California, United States (On-Site)

Massachusetts, United States (On-Site)

Santa Clara, California, United States (On-Site)

Santa Clara, California, United States (On-Site)

Santa Clara, California, United States (On-Site)

Texas, United States (On-Site)

Santa Clara, California, United States (On-Site)

Santa Clara, California, United States (Hybrid)

Santa Clara, California, United States (Hybrid)

View All Jobs

Get notified when new jobs are added by NVIDIA

Level Up Your Career in Game Development!

Transform Your Passion into Profession with Our Comprehensive Courses for Aspiring Game Developers.

Job Common Plug